Barry's is the Best Workout in the WorldTM. Founded in West Hollywood in 1998, it's the original strength and cardio interval fitness experience that provides an immersive, high-intensity, one-hour workout that's as effective as it is fun. Our fitness classes alternate between working out with weights and running on a treadmill. Each day focuses on a different muscle group in order to achieve real results and to prevent injuries. Our program is designed to tone muscle and maximize fat loss, while spiking the metabolism for up to 48 hours following the class. About the role The Apparel Graphic Designer is responsible for conceptualizing, designing, and executing graphic elements for the Barry's Retail division. This role combines artistic vision with industry trends to create designs that resonate with target audiences and align with Barry's brand identity. This role requires a high level of passion and creativity, along with the versatility and focus to contribute to graphic direction and strategy through the product creation process. The ideal candidate will have experience with contemporary athleisure and performance apparel, well-rounded knowledge of graphic techniques, and is an Adobe CC expert. The Apparel Graphic Designer works to elevate the Barry's Brand and co-branded product with a focus on the art and design of graphics to create a compelling consumer experience for our retail sold in studios and online. What you'll do • Conceptualize and design original, on-brand graphics for retail collections, including prints, patterns, logos, and typography • Create innovative graphic applications for placement on retail apparel and accessories, including screen print graphics, embroidery, and repeat designs • Collaborate with product development, merchandising, and brand teams to align designs with seasonal goals, market trends, and Barry's brand identity • Research trends, consumer preferences, and competitor offerings to inspire new designs and elevate existing concepts • Create seasonal vision boards that includes color direction, as well as trim, textures and typography influences that communicate the ethos of Barry's • Prepare detailed technical packs with accurate scaling, placement, and color specifications for production, as well as CAD drawings as needed • Ensure brand consistency by working closely with the brand and marketing teams to maintain a cohesive visual language across both digital and retail touchpoints • Create and maintain line sheets, look books, merchandising guides, and other retail tools in alignment with Barry's brand guidelines and marketing strategies • Support and ensure any design deadlines are met according to the development calendar. • Perform other related duties as needed Qualifications • 4+ years industry experience working as a Graphic Designer within a fitness apparel or print company, preferably in Men's and Women's Athleisure or Active Apparel and Accessories. • MA, BA, BFA, or BS in Graphic Design • Skilled in hand illustration, as well as in Adobe CC: Illustrator, Photoshop, and InDesign • Excel in designing graphic layouts, repeat patterns, and a great sense of typography • Well-rounded knowledge of various printing techniques and how to communicate these directions to domestic and overseas vendors. • Expert in artwork file preparation for print, design process, and tech packs • Knowledge of Digital Photography and how to import/manipulate digital media • Ability to present creative fashion forward ideas aligned with Barry's vision • Ability to meet deadlines, prioritize projects appropriately, manage a very fast pace graphic design workload - multi-task and organizational qualities are a must! • Self starter, capable of problem-solving and suggesting solutions • Ability to work well under pressure and adapt to changing priorities Apply tot his job
